        I just joined this forum as caregiver for my 75 yr old dad. Initial spot removed from forearm March 2020. PET scans good until Nov 2021. Metastasized to lung, surgically removed, margins and lymph nodes clear. Brain MRI results today clear. BUT oncologist estimates he has 6 months to live because it is NRAS mutation. She told him if it were her dad, she would say “wait and see” if it spreads before starting immunotherapy because “quality of life” for those 6 months. Meaning it’s hopeless. I’m looking for hope – any kind of feedback on NRAS treatment or specialists. I adore my dad and am heartbroken. Thank you and my best to everyone battling this.
